Human germline editing alters DNA in eggs, sperm, or early embryos so changes are inheritable. The technology’s relevance rests on its potential to prevent severe genetic disorders but also on the scale of its consequences for individuals, families, and societies. Jennifer Doudna at the University of California, Berkeley has urged caution and broad societal deliberation given the technical uncertainties and ethical stakes. Institutional reviews such as those by the National Academies of Sciences, Engineering, and Medicine emphasize that policy should be driven by both scientific evidence and public values.
Scientific and safety limits
Technical limits should be the first ethical guardrail. Off-target mutations, mosaicism where not all cells carry the intended edit, and incomplete understanding of gene interactions create real safety risks for the person born and for descendants. The World Health Organization has stated that clinical application of heritable genome modification is premature until robust evidence demonstrates safety, efficacy, and reproducibility. Ethical limits therefore include requiring preclinical proof of low risk, transparent peer-reviewed validation, and independent oversight before any clinical use is contemplated. Until such standards are met, a moratorium on reproductive applications protects future persons from avoidable harm.
Justice, consent, and social consequences
Beyond safety, ethical limits must address consent, equity, and social harms. Germline edits affect future persons who cannot consent, raising questions about whether speculative benefits justify irreversible interventions. Françoise Baylis at Dalhousie University argues that permitting heritable modification risks exacerbating social inequality and introducing new forms of discrimination if access is shaped by wealth, cultural capital, or national policies. Without global coordination, jurisdictions with permissive regulation can become destinations for reproductive services, undermining protective standards in less permissive territories and creating cross-border ethical tourism.
Cultural and territorial nuances
Attitudes toward heredity, disability, and parental responsibility vary across cultures, so governance must be sensitive to local values while upholding core ethical protections. Indigenous communities or populations with histories of coercive reproductive policies may reasonably view germline interventions with particular mistrust, making inclusive engagement and respect for autonomy essential. Environmental and population-level effects also have territorial dimensions: heritable changes could alter allele frequencies within populations over generations, with unpredictable impacts on genetic diversity important for resilience.
Governance and practical limits
Ethical limits should combine substantive prohibitions and procedural safeguards. Substantive limits would bar non-therapeutic enhancements and alterations aimed at traits linked to social advantage rather than health. Procedural safeguards include international registries, independent review boards, community engagement, and enforceable transparency requirements. A framework that grounds decisions in scientific validity, respect for individuals and communities, and attention to distributive justice is most defensible. As Jennifer Doudna and institutions such as the National Academies and the World Health Organization have emphasized, responsible stewardship requires slowing clinical deployment until robust evidence, broad public dialogue, and international governance mechanisms are in place.
